CPU for Video Editing: The Ultimate 2026 Guide for Faster Rendering & Smooth Workflow

Choosing the right CPU for video editing is one of the most important decisions for content creators  filmmakers  and professional editors. The processor (CPU) directly affects how fast your videos render  how smoothly your timeline plays  and how efficiently your editing software performs.

Whether you’re editing 1080p YouTube videos  4K cinematic projects  or heavy 8K footage  your CPU determines the overall speed and stability of your workflow.

In this complete guide  we will explore the best CPUs for video editing  key features to look for  comparisons between Intel and AMD  and expert recommendations for beginners and professionals.

Why CPU Matters for Video Editing

The CPU (Central Processing Unit) is the brain of your computer. In video editing  it handles:

  • Rendering video files
  • Encoding and exporting videos
  • Playback of timeline previews
  • Processing effects and transitions
  • Multitasking during editing

A weak CPU can cause:

  • Laggy timeline playback
  • Slow rendering
  • Software crashes
  • Delayed exports

A powerful CPU ensures smooth  fast  and efficient editing performance.

Key CPU Specifications for Video Editing

Before choosing a CPU  understand the important specifications:

  1. Core Count

More cores = better multitasking.

  • 4–6 cores → Basic editing
  • 8–12 cores → 4K editing
  • 16+ cores → Professional workloads
  1. Thread Count

Threads improve parallel processing.

  • Higher threads = faster rendering
  • Essential for heavy effects and exports
  1. Clock Speed (GHz)

Higher clock speed improves real-time performance.

  • Important for timeline playback
  • Helps with effects and transitions
  1. Cache Memory

Larger cache improves data access speed.

  • Better performance in large projects
  1. Thermal Efficiency

Good cooling = stable performance during long edits.

Intel vs AMD for Video Editing

There are two major CPU brands dominating the market:

Intel CPUs

Popular models:

  • Intel Core i5
  • Intel Core i7
  • Intel Core i9

Strengths:

  • Strong single-core performance
  • Excellent software optimization
  • Great for Adobe software

Best For:

  • Adobe Premiere Pro users
  • Fast timeline editing
  • Windows-based editing setups

AMD CPUs

Popular models:

  • Ryzen 5
  • Ryzen 7
  • Ryzen 9

Strengths:

  • More cores for the price
  • Excellent multi-core performance
  • Better rendering speed

Best For:

  • DaVinci Resolve users
  • Heavy rendering tasks
  • Budget-to-midrange builds

Best CPUs for Video Editing in 2026

Here are the top processors used by professional video editors.

  1. Intel Core i9-14900K (Best Overall Intel CPU)

Features:

  • 24 cores (8 performance + 16 efficiency cores)
  • High clock speed up to 6.0 GHz
  • Excellent multitasking

Why It’s Great:

  • Extremely fast rendering
  • Smooth playback in Premiere Pro
  • Handles 4K and 8K editing easily

Best For:

  • Professional editors
  • YouTube creators
  • Filmmakers
  1. AMD Ryzen 9 7950X (Best Overall AMD CPU)

Features:

  • 16 cores / 32 threads
  • High multi-core performance
  • Efficient power usage

Why It’s Great:

  • Faster rendering in heavy projects
  • Excellent for DaVinci Resolve
  • Great price-to-performance ratio

Best For:

  • Professional video editors
  • Color grading workflows
  • 3D + video editing
  1. Intel Core i7-14700K (Best Mid-Range Intel CPU)

Features:

  • 20 cores total
  • Balanced performance
  • Strong single-core speed

Why It’s Great:

  • Affordable high performance
  • Great for 4K editing
  • Stable Adobe workflow

Best For:

  • Intermediate editors
  • YouTube creators
  1. AMD Ryzen 7 7800X3D (Best Gaming + Editing CPU)

Features:

  • 8 cores / 16 threads
  • Large 3D V-Cache
  • High efficiency

Why It’s Great:

  • Great for gaming + editing
  • Smooth timeline playback
  • Energy efficient

Best For:

  • Gaming YouTubers
  • Hybrid creators
  1. Intel Core i5-13600K (Best Budget CPU for Editing)

Features:

  • 14 cores (6 performance + 8 efficiency)
  • Strong performance for price

Why It’s Great:

  • Affordable entry into editing
  • Good for 1080p and light 4K editing

Best For:

  • Beginners
  • Students
  • Freelancers
  1. AMD Ryzen 5 7600X (Best Budget AMD CPU)

Features:

  • 6 cores / 12 threads
  • High clock speed
  • Efficient architecture

Why It’s Great:

  • Budget-friendly editing
  • Smooth basic workflows

Best For:

  • Beginner editors
  • Light content creation

CPU Requirements Based on Video Resolution

1080p Editing

  • 4–6 cores
  • Intel i5 / Ryzen 5

4K Editing

  • 8–12 cores
  • Intel i7 / Ryzen 7

6K–8K Editing

  • 16+ cores
  • Intel i9 / Ryzen 9

How CPU Affects Video Editing Software

Different software uses CPU power differently.

Adobe Premiere Pro

  • Relies on single-core performance
  • Benefits from Intel CPUs
  • GPU acceleration also important

DaVinci Resolve

  • Uses both CPU and GPU heavily
  • AMD CPUs perform very well

Final Cut Pro (Mac)

  • Optimized for Apple silicon CPUs
  • Extremely fast rendering

CPU vs GPU in Video Editing

Many beginners confuse CPU and GPU roles.

CPU Handles:

  • Encoding
  • Timeline processing
  • Effects calculation

GPU Handles:

  • Rendering effects
  • Playback acceleration
  • Color grading

Best performance comes from a balanced CPU + GPU setup.

Recommended Video Editing PC Build (2026)

Budget Build:

  • Ryzen 5 7600X
  • 16GB RAM
  • RTX 3060
  • SSD storage

Mid-Range Build:

  • Intel i7-14700K
  • 32GB RAM
  • RTX 4070

Professional Build:

  • Ryzen 9 7950X
  • 64GB RAM
  • RTX 4090
  • NVMe Gen 4 SSD

Tips for Improving CPU Performance in Editing

  1. Use Proxy Files

Reduces CPU load during editing.

  1. Enable GPU Acceleration

Balances CPU workload.

  1. Close Background Apps

Frees up processing power.

  1. Optimize Timeline Settings

Lower playback resolution.

  1. Keep Software Updated

Improves CPU optimization.

Common Mistakes When Choosing a CPU

  • Buying too many cores without need
  • Ignoring single-core performance
  • Not balancing GPU and RAM
  • Choosing outdated generation CPUs
